S.1 - American Competitiveness Act

Official Summary

1/25/2011--Introduced.Expresses the sense of the Senate that Congress should: -eliminate tax loopholes that encourage companies to ship American jobs overseas; -expand markets for United States exports; -promote the development of new, innovative products bearing the inscription "Made in America"; - modernize and improve U.S. highways, bridges, and transit systems; - modernize and upgrade U.S. rail, levees, dams, and ports; - place computers in classrooms; -ensure that U.S. small businesses and households have access to high-speed broadband; - invest in critical new infrastructure; - streamline U.S. regulatory policies.
